I'm not suggesting this is the case here, but we built a pickup truck one time that was a four speed trans but didn't have the floor cut out in the cab. We didn't notice the mistake until body drop.
My repair man chopped the hole in the floor with a hammer and chisel - while the line was still running and the cab was teetering unsecured on the chassis. K
